Làm App Mobile Cần Bao Nhiêu Thời Gian?

Bạn đang thắc mắc về thời gian cần thiết để làm App Mobile hoàn chỉnh? Bài viết này sẽ đi sâu phân tích và cho bạn câu trả lời chính xác nhất.

Cần bao nhiêu thời gian để làm App Mobile?
Cần bao nhiêu thời gian để làm App Mobile?

Để thiết kế ứng dụng di động (hay App Mobile) mất bao lâu là một trong những câu hỏi mà doanh nghiệp cần quan tâm và đi tìm câu trả lời chính xác. Từ đó bắt tay vào xây dựng App Mobile dành riêng cho sản phẩm/dịch vụ và doanh nghiệp của mình. Việc sở hữu ứng dụng di động riêng không chỉ khiến doanh nghiệp tiếp cận với số lượng lớn khách hàng tiềm năng mà nó cũng khiến khách hàng nhận diện rõ nét hơn về thương hiệu và những sản phẩm/dịch vụ mà doanh nghiệp đang kinh doanh.

Ở bài viết này, Solutions World sẽ phân tích về quy trình cơ bản thường gặp của việc làm App Mobile và xác định khoảng thời gian cần để thiết kế một ứng dụng hoàn chỉnh.

Xây dựng Wireframe trước khi làm App Mobile

Dựng Wireframe có nghĩa là xác định thứ bậc thông tin của thiết kế. Lúc này, phía doanh nghiệp sẽ cùng nhà phát triển ứng dụng xây dựng nên bố cục Wireframe theo hướng đơn giản và dễ hiểu nhất cho người dùng nhưng vẫn đảm bảo phải theo hướng mà doanh nghiệp muốn khách hàng xử lý thông tin.

Xây dựng Wireframe là bước đầu tiên và quan trọng trong quá trình làm App Mobile
Xây dựng Wireframe là bước đầu tiên và quan trọng trong quá trình làm App Mobile

Đây là bước rất quan trọng vì nếu không xác định được nơi đặt thông tin thì sẽ không thể có các bước tiếp theo trong quy trình làm App Mobile.

Bên cạnh đó, một Wireframe sẽ giúp cho doanh nghiệp xác định được cách người dùng tương tác trên ứng dụng của mình. Từ đó, việc nghiên cứu hành vi, thói quen hay Insight của khách hàng trên App Mobile cũng thuận tiện và hiệu quả hơn rất nhiều.

Doanh nghiệp cần cung cấp đầy đủ các mô tả mong muốn và nội dung của ứng dụng cho đơn vị cung cấp dịch vụ làm App gồm có:

  • Nội dung trên các phần như Header, Footer, Sidebar…
  • Nội dung trên từng trang của ứng dụng
  • Những mong muốn đối với các chức năng trên giao diện
  • Các kỳ vọng về tương tác của người dùng trên Wireframe

Thời gian thực hiện của bước này sẽ phụ thuộc vào quá trình bạn và bên cung cấp dịch vụ trao đổi/phản hồi nhanh hay chậm. Thông thường sẽ mất khoảng gần 1 tháng để đi đến thống nhất cuối cùng cho giai đoạn này.

Thiết kế giao diện cho App

Sau khi đã lên nội dung và dựng bố cục chi tiết cho Wireframe, chúng ta sẽ bắt tay vào thiết kế giao diện. Đây sẽ là bước quan trọng trong quy trình làm App Mobile, nhằm tạo ra thứ hữu hình mà người dùng sẽ nhìn thấy.

Tùy thuộc vào mức độ phức tạp của Font chữ, nút bấm, bố cục hình ảnh trên ứng dụng… thời gian sẽ có dao động. Ước lượng khoảng thời gian cần để hoàn thành thiết kế giao diện cho một ứng dụng là từ 3 tuần cho đến 1 tháng.

Kiểm tra giao diện của ứng dụng

Thực tế đã chứng minh rằng, một ứng dụng thân thiện với người dùng sẽ có lượt tải cao hơn so với những App được phát triển tốt nhưng có giao diện không được tối ưu, khó sử dụng.

Một App Mobile có giao diện hiển thị hoàn hảo trên một thiết bị, nhưng ở một thiết bị khác, nó không hề dễ sử dụng. Nguyên nhân thường gặp là do sự khác nhau về kích thước của thiết bị di động hoặc nền tảng hệ điều hành,… dẫn đến ứng dụng hiển thị không đẹp mắt, để lại ấn tượng xấu cho người dùng.

Chính vì lẽ đó, bước kiểm tra giao diện của ứng dụng là vô cùng cần thiết trong quy trình làm App Mobile mà doanh nghiệp nên lưu ý kỹ. Bạn cần để ý kiểm tra một số điểm sau đối với giao diện của App Mobile:

Độ phân giải màn hình

Một số độ phân giải phổ biến được dùng để xem xét trong quá trình kiểm tra giao diện của ứng dụng di động:

  • 640 × 480
  • 800 × 600
  • 1024 × 768
  • 1280 × 800
  • 1366 × 768
  • 1400 × 900
  • 1680 × 1050

Kích thước màn hình hiển thị

Bạn cần phải kiểm tra giao diện của ứng dụng trên nhiều thiết bị với độ phân giải khác nhau nhằm đảm bảo hiển thị chính xác và đảm bảo tính thẩm mỹ. Ngoài ra, bạn cung nên Test thử xem ứng dụng hiển thị như thế nào trên dạng màn hình ngang và dọc của các thiết bị.

Font chữ, kích cỡ chữ và màu sắc

Dù Font chữ, kích cỡ chữ hay màu sắc không làm ảnh hưởng đến các chức năng và hoạt động của ứng dụng, nhưng cũng cần hết sức lưu ý đến chúng.

Chẳng hạn, thiết kế và Font chữ trên ứng dụng phải nhất quán và liên quan mật thiết với những gì bạn đã thể hiện trên sản phẩm hay Website… của mình. Người dùng chỉ cần nhìn vào App Mobile là đã có thể nhận ra sản phẩm hoặc doanh nghiệp của bạn. Làm App Mobile có thiết kế đẹp mắt, màu sắc phù hợp chính là bạn đang xây dựng một mối liên hệ thân thiện với người dùng của mình.

Các yếu tố UI khác

Các yếu tố đó là diện mạo và kích thước của các nút điều hướng, các tiêu đề, hình ảnh, biểu tượng, văn bản, Checkboxes… trên màn hình.

Để hoàn thành các bước kiểm tra giao diện ứng dụng, bạn có thể mất khoảng 2 tuần.

Làm App Mobile

Bước có thể được thực hiện cùng lúc với với quá trình thiết kế giao diện cho ứng dụng. Nếu doanh nghiệp của bạn hoặc đơn vị thuê ngoài đang xây dựng giao diện cho ứng dụng, bạn cần có các chỉ chi tiết cho các chức năng vừa tạo. Lập trình viên sẽ dựa theo thiết kế này để tạo mã code nền và phát triển các mã code chức năng.

Lập trình ứng dụng dựa trên thiết kế giao diện đã thực hiện
Lập trình ứng dụng dựa trên thiết kế giao diện đã thực hiện

Nếu mã code nền (do bên bạn tạo) hoặc các chỉ dẫn về giao diện của ứng dụng không được rõ ràng thì sẽ gây khó khăn trong quá trình làm App, thậm chí là giảm năng suất làm việc của các lập trình viên.

Việc mã Code của chức năng được phát triển như thế nào sẽ phụ thuộc vào yêu cầu của doanh nghiệp đó là làm App di động (Native App) hay làm App đa nền tảng (Cross – Platform).

Một số đơn vị cung cấp dịch vụ làm App Mobile chuyên nghiệp như Solutions World sẽ thông báo thời gian hoàn thành sản phẩm ngay khi đã nắm rõ yêu cầu làm App của doanh nghiệp. Điều này sẽ giúp cho doanh nghiệp của bạn dễ dàng hơn trong việc kế hoạch giới thiệu ứng dụng đến với khách hàng mục tiêu, hoặc các kế hoạch khác liên quan đến App Mobile.

Solutions World sử dụng ngôn ngữ lập trình Kotlin, Java để làm App Mobile trên hệ điều hành Android; dùng ngôn ngữ lập trình Swift, Objective-c để thiết kế ứng dụng trên iOS. Đối với các ứng dụng đa nền tảng, Xamarin, Phonegap, Flutter, React-native là các ngôn ngữ lập trình được chúng tôi sử dụng để lập trình các tính năng.

Tùy vào độ phức tạp của App Mobile mà doanh nghiệp yêu cầu, giai đoạn này có thể kéo dài từ 3 tháng đến 6 tháng.

Test các tính năng của ứng dụng

Sau khi làm App Mobile xong, bước tiếp theo chúng ta đảm bảo rằng ứng dụng đã có đầy đủ các chức năng cần thiết và hoạt động một cách nhất quán.

Vì ứng dụng di động tiếp cận rất nhiều với thông tin cá nhân của người dùng nên nếu có bất cứ một lỗi nào phát sinh thì tạo ra ảnh hưởng rất lớn đến hình ảnh thương hiệu của doanh nghiệp, thất thoát tiền bạc và thậm chí có thể vướng vào vấn đề về pháp lý.

Đây là một công việc tốn khá nhiều thời gian trong quá trình làm App Mobile nếu các chức năng chưa thực sự hoàn thiện và hoạt động trơn tru.

Test tính năng của App nó bao gồm việc kiểm tra khả năng tương tác với người dùng và kiểm thử quá trình thực hiện giao dịch. Các yếu tố quan trọng cần được kiểm tra như:

  • Tốc độ chuyển đổi điều hướng giữa các trang trên ứng dụng
  • Yêu cầu về bộ nhớ của App
  • App tiêu tốn lượng Pin bao nhiêu khi hoạt động trên thiết bị
  • Kiểm tra tính năng, đảm bảo rằng ứng dụng không bị “crash” khi không kết nối được với Internet hoặc do các tác động bên ngoài khác
  • Chạy thử phiên bản Beta của App Mobile

Một số đơn vị làm App Mobile giới thiệu ứng dụng hoặc các tính năng mới đến với khán giả trước khi chính thức phát hành. Chương trình thử nghiệm ứng dụng thường được gọi là “chương trình thử nghiệm và truy cập sớm” hoặc “phiên bản Beta”. Những người dùng đăng ký sử dụng sớm sẽ có cơ hội được trải nghiệm các tính năng mới và phản hồi ý kiến đến cho nhà phát triển App.

Công việc kiểm tra này sẽ mất một khoảng thời gian lâu từ 1 – 2 tháng để các chuyên gia có thể thu thập về đủ những đánh giá từ khách hàng và thực hiện thay đổi trước khi tung ra phiên bản ứng dụng chính thức.

Tóm lại, để làm App Mobile doanh nghiệp sẽ phải dành ra một khoảng thời gian từ 3 – 8 tháng, tùy thuộc vào các yếu tố, điều kiện khác nhau. Nhưng điều quan trọng đó là cần có sự phối hợp ăn ý giữa các bên có liên quan thì mới có thể tạo ra sản phẩm App Mobile hoàn hảo trong thời gian nhanh chóng nhất.

Quá trình làm App Mobile diễn ra nhanh hay chậm cũng liên quan đến mức độ uy tín, chuyên nghiệp của đơn vị cung cấp dịch vụ thiết kế App. Nếu những công ty phát triển App có quy trình làm App rõ ràng và tác phong làm việc chuyên nghiệp như Solutions World thì thời gian làm App có thể được rút ngắn nhờ vào trình độ chuyên môn và kinh nghiệm được đúc kết không ngừng.

Leave a Comment

Email của bạn sẽ không được hiển thị công khai.